WebTraditional Chinese medicine sees yin and yang. If the bladder can't hold urine, this is deficiency of kidney yin. Deficiency of kidney yang is indicated if you're cold, with lowered libido and impotence, abundance of pale urination especially at night, and lower backache.

WebMar 4, 2024 · Hachi-mi-jio-gan: Chinese herbal formulation that is supposed to lower bladder contractions, thus reducing the need to urinate. Saw palmetto: Shrub-like palm common in eastern parts of the U.S. that may calm the nerves around the bladder and reduce OAB symptoms.

Urinary incontinence, the loss of bladder control, is a common and often embarrassing problem. The severity ranges from occasionally leaking urine when coughing or sneezing to having an urge to urinate that's so sudden and ...
